Nope. ON 2003 is separate. You'll have to buy it individually, but I
would not advise to do so. OneNote 2007 is by lengths better than
OneNote 2003.
Trial versions for 2007 will be available for download on December 1. I
don't know how long the trials will be good for (trials could be as
short as 30 days and as long as 180 days, but we don't know yet). My
personal suspicion is that it is at least 60 days, because 2007 won't be
available for purchase for retail/oem customers until the end of
January.
